A type of gear in which the wheels can be disengaged or reversed, allowing for directional change in machinery.
A mechanical gear arrangement where one gear (the tumbler) can be moved to engage with either of two other gears, thereby reversing the direction of rotation.
Linguistics
Semantic Notes
A highly specialized term primarily used in mechanical engineering and machinery design. The word 'tumbler' refers to the gear that 'tumbles' or rocks between positions.

- This old lathe uses a tumbler gear to change the lead screw direction.
- By engaging the tumbler gear with the opposite driving gear, the operator can reverse the feed of the carriage.
- The design incorporates a tumbler gear to allow for both forward and reverse threading without stopping the spindle.

A standard gear is fixed in its engagement. A tumbler gear is mounted on a pivoting lever ('tumbler') so it can be moved to engage with one of two other gears, enabling reversal.
Historically in metalworking lathes, early milling machines, and some textile machinery where a simple, manually operated direction change was required.
